Bonjour tout le monde.
J'essaye de commander un relais pour enclencher un chauffage.
Comme je ne connais pas bien l'utilisation du GPIO du Raspberry PiZero 2W, j'ai donc utilisé un exemple trouvé sur le net pour faire coller et décoller un relais sans arrêt.
Voici le code simple :
Code Python :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
#!/usr/bin/env python3
 
import RPi.GPIO as GPIO
import time
 
GPIO.setmode(GPIO.BCM)
GPIO.setup(4, GPIO.OUT)
 
while True:
    GPIO.output(4,True)
    time.sleep(5)
    GPIO.output(4,False)
    time.sleep(5)
Le problème que je rencontre est que le relais fonctionne aléatoirement 2, 3, 4 fois et s'arrête alors que le programme continue normalement.
Merci pour votre aide.
A+